QIMA Company Profile
Background
Overview
QIMA is a global leader in quality control and compliance solutions, specializing in Testing, Inspection, and Certification (TIC) services for the consumer products, food and agriculture commodities, and life sciences industries. Founded in 2005 by Sébastien Breteau in Hong Kong, the company has expanded its reach to over 100 countries, serving more than 30,000 businesses worldwide.

Financials and Funding
Funding History
QIMA has attracted significant investment to fuel its growth and expansion. In December 2021, Caisse de Depot et Placement du Quebec (CDPQ) acquired a minority stake in QIMA, providing capital to support the company's strategic initiatives.

Pipeline Development
Key Pipeline Candidates
QIMA's strategic growth is supported by a series of acquisitions aimed at expanding its service capabilities and market reach:
- Edward Food Research and Analysis Centre Pvt Ltd (EFRAC): Acquired in August 2024, EFRAC is an India-based research center providing food safety solutions, including food testing and research facilities for the food industry.
- NYCE: Acquired in September 2020, NYCE is a provider of training, certification, inspection, and laboratory services.
- WQS Food Verification, LLC: Acquired in September 2019, WQS offers audits, certifications, inspections, and supply chain management services for the retail, aquaculture, and food and beverage sectors.

Competitor Profile
Market Insights and Dynamics
The global Testing, Inspection, and Certification (TIC) market is projected to grow from USD 239.48 billion in 2025 to USD 282.76 billion by 2030. This growth is driven by increasing demand for quality assurance and compliance across various industries.
